N5006P is a 1957 Piper PA-24. It is a fixed-wing single-engine aircraft with 4 seats, powered by a Lycoming O&VO-360 SER rated at 180 horsepower. The registration is active, with the registrant based in Cleveland, OK. Its standard airworthiness certificate was issued in Nov 1957. It has been registered to its current owner since Nov 2001.
